Lead, Platinum, and Other Heavy Elements in the Primary Cosmic Radiation--HEAO-3 Results
Abstract
This paper reports an observation of the abundances of cosmic-ray lead and platinum-group nuclei using data from the HEAO-3 Heavy Nuclei Experiment (HNE) which consisted of ion chambers mounted on both sides of a plastic Cherenkov counter (Binns et al., 1981). Previously we have reported on a search for actinide nuclei, Z > 88 (Binns, et al. 1982a). Further analysis with more stringent selections, inclusion of additional data, and a calibration at the LBL Bevalac, have allowed us to obtain the abundance ratio of lead and the platinum group of elements for particles that had a cutoff rigidity R_c > 5 GV.
